Role summary

Finite State is seeking a Head of Policy and Compliance Solutions to lead our strategic response to the evolving global cybersecurity regulatory landscape. This role is critical to helping our customers navigate complex compliance requirements while positioning Finite State as the definitive authority on connected product security regulations. You will serve as a strategic leader, blending deep regulatory expertise, executive-level consulting experience, and cross-functional collaboration skills to help customers achieve compliance confidence across their connected product portfolios.

As a key member of the leadership team, the Head of Policy and Compliance Solutions will ensure we deliver exceptional regulatory guidance and compliance solutions through a combination of policy expertise, executive-level communication, and scalable service delivery. This is a high-impact, hands-on role for a proven leader who thrives in a fast-paced, mission-driven startup environment and has a passion for shaping the future of connected product security.

 

Responsibilities:

Regulatory & Policy Leadership

  • Serve as the senior authority on global cybersecurity regulations impacting connected products, with deep expertise in CE RED, EU CRA, Connected Vehicle Rule, Cyber Trust Mark, and emerging regulatory frameworks.

  • Monitor, analyze, and interpret evolving cybersecurity policies, regulations, and legislation across multiple jurisdictions and industry verticals.

  • Maintain fluency in regulatory trends affecting consumer and industrial connected products, energy sector, automotive, medical devices, and other critical infrastructure.

Customer & Executive Engagement

  • Engage directly with CISOs, Chief Compliance Officers, VPs of Engineering, and other C-suite stakeholders to provide strategic regulatory guidance.

  • Lead executive-level discussions on compliance strategy, risk assessment, and regulatory roadmaps for complex connected product portfolios.

  • Act as trusted advisor for key accounts navigating regulatory challenges and compliance timelines.

Solution Development & Market Positioning

  • Collaborate with Product and Engineering teams to ensure Finite State's platform addresses current and anticipated regulatory requirements.

  • Translate regulatory mandates into actionable compliance solutions and service offerings.

  • Position Finite State as the market leader in regulatory compliance for connected product security through thought leadership and industry engagement.

Cross-Functional Leadership

  • Partner closely with Legal, Product, Sales, Marketing, and Operations teams to align regulatory insights with business strategy.

  • Support complex sales cycles by providing regulatory expertise, compliance assessments, and competitive differentiation.

  • Contribute to overall GTM strategy, including pipeline acceleration through regulatory value proposition.

Industry & Government Relations

  • Interface directly with regulators, auditors, and government agencies to stay ahead of policy developments.

  • Represent Finite State at industry conferences, regulatory workshops, and standards committees.

  • Build and maintain relationships with key stakeholders in the regulatory ecosystem.

Program Expansion & Team Development

  • Expand and enhance existing compliance programs to meet growing customer demand.

  • Provide strategic direction to and collaborate with individual contributors across the organization.

  • Develop scalable processes and frameworks for delivering regulatory guidance and compliance solutions.

What we’re looking for:

  • 10+ years in cybersecurity policy, regulatory compliance, or related fields with a proven track record of senior-level impact.

  • Deep expertise in connected product cybersecurity regulations, such as CE RED, EU CRA, Connected Vehicle Rule, Cyber Trust Mark, and related frameworks.

  • Strong understanding of compliance requirements across multiple industry verticals including automotive, medical devices, energy, and consumer electronics.

  • Government experience with regulatory agencies, policy development, or legislative processes.

  • Consulting experience with executive-level client engagement and strategic advisory services.

  • Technology sector experience with B2B SaaS platforms and connected product ecosystems.

  • Executive-level presence and the ability to engage confidently with C-suite executives and regulatory officials.

  • Strong business acumen and experience translating regulatory requirements into market opportunities.

  • Excellent verbal and written communication skills with the ability to distill complex regulatory concepts for diverse audiences.

  • Experience operating in early-stage or high-growth technology environments.

  • Advanced degree in Law, Public Policy, Engineering, or related field preferred.

  • Willingness to travel domestically and internationally for customer engagements and regulatory meetings.
